首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 93 毫秒
1.
韩冰 《科技信息》2008,(3):220-220
指针是一个特殊的变量,它里面存储的数值被解释成为内存里的一个地址。在C语言中指针的概念比较复杂,使用也比较灵活。每一个学习和使用C语言的人都应当深入地学习和掌握指针。本文介绍了指针的概念、指针和数组的关系,并深入探讨了指向结构体类型数组的指针变量及其定义方法,同时通过实际问题详细说明了如何灵活应用指向结构体数组的指针及使用时应该注意的问题。  相似文献   

2.
描述了C语言指针数组的特征以及用指针数组编制实用高效程序的方法.在软件开发中,常需要开辟数百KB的内存缓冲区,而在C语言中设置这样大的内存缓冲区会出现数据跨段的问题,采用指针数组的使用机制能解决以上难题.利用指针数组法建立稀疏数组,可使内存使用率增高且能方便地实现读写操作  相似文献   

3.
在C语言的教学中,“指针”这一部分内容一直是C语言的教学重点和难点,能否正确理解和使用指针是衡量学生是否掌握C语言这门课的一个重要标志,也直接影响学生对《数据结构》和《操作系统》等后续课程的学习和把握.以教学中存在的问题为切入点,从指针概念的正确理解、使用中常犯错误和灵活应用等方面较详细地介绍了教学中的经验和体会.  相似文献   

4.
指针是C语言中广泛使用的一种数据类型。运用指针编程是C语言最主要的风格之一,它是c中的难点和重点。文中在介绍指针的概念的基础上把指针不同的形式分成两大类讲述,让学习指针的人更好的理解与记忆。  相似文献   

5.
周涛 《科技信息》2011,(26):207-208
在C语言程序设计中,指针是精华、是难点也是重点,不能正确使用指针就没有掌握C语言程序设计的精华。而数组又是同一类型的有序数据的集合,在程序设计中应用也非常广泛。本文针对C语言程序设计中二者结合使用的不易理解性做了详细的论述,对教师的教学及学生理解起到了很大的帮助作用。  相似文献   

6.
就C语言教学中数组名的量纲、数组名与指针的关系及指针的本质等教材和讲授中容易产生理解误区的内容进行了探讨,总结了C语言中数组定义和引用语句间的内在联系,将其归纳为“升格降格法”用以对数组和指针的使用进行量纲判断.  相似文献   

7.
指针是c语言中广泛使用的一种数据类型。运用指针编程是c语言最主要的风格之一,它是c的难点和重点。本人通过总结多年的教学经验发现很多学生认为指针学习起来比较困难,很难理解。文中在介绍指针的概念的基础上把指针的内涵及常用方法进行讲述,让学习指针的人更好的理解与记忆。  相似文献   

8.
指针是C语言的精华,详细论述了C语言中指针与变量、指针与数组、指针与字符串、指针与函数以及指针与结构体之间的关系.指针与其他数据类型配合,可以让C程序设计更加灵活和方便.  相似文献   

9.
指针是C语言的重要组成部分。灵活的使用指针可以提高程序的执行效率,可以建立动态数组,可以灵活的处理字符串等等。本文简要介绍了指针的重要作用,从而使初学者更好地了解使用指针的必要性。  相似文献   

10.
张峻 《科技资讯》2009,(17):28-29
本文创造性地提出了“地址就是指针”,该结论是理解数组和指针关系的基础;创造性地提出“点指针和行指针”的概念,这些概念很好区分了多维数组中两种不同类型的指针;在此基础上,进一步认为“数组名称既表示地址,又表示指针”“,二维数组array[n][m],可以认为是含有array[0],array[1]……array[n-1]等n个元素的一维数组,而这些元素是包含了m个具体元素的一维数组;一维数组名称,如array[0],array[1]……array[n-1]是点指针,二维数组名称array是行指针”。  相似文献   

11.
文章探讨了C语言程序设计中指针与数组的关系 ,通过对相应的程序设计方法的分析认为 :若是顺序访问数组 ,指针访问最快 ;若是随机访问数组 ,使用下标更好  相似文献   

12.
通过指针可以设计出更加高效、灵活、简洁的C程序.作者主要从指针的自加减运算、指针作为函数参数、指针与动态多维数组和指针数组四方面,分析了指针应用对C程序效率的影响.  相似文献   

13.
针对学生在学习指针过程中遇到的困难及使用指针过程中出现的常见错误,讨论指针的概念、指针与数组的关系、指针与函数的关系、指针作为函数参数的实质,帮助学生克服困难和错误。  相似文献   

14.
刘洪霞 《科技信息》2010,(24):I0394-I0394,I0396
在C语言中,数组在使用前必须进行定义,一旦定义了一个数组,系统将为它分配一个所申请大小的空间,该大小固定,以后不能改变,称为静态数组。但在编程过程中,有时我们所需的内存空间无法预先确定,对于这个问题,用静态数组的办法很难解决。为了解决这个问题,C语言提供了一些内存管理函数,这些内存管理函数结合指针可以按需要动态地分配内存空间,来构建动态数组。本文就从动态数组的定义,使用两个方面介绍一下动态数组是如何构建的。  相似文献   

15.
介绍了指针的相关概念,对C语言指针教学中的几个难点进行了分析,探讨了指针对C程序效率的影响。  相似文献   

16.
关于C语言教学中指针的探讨   总被引:1,自引:0,他引:1  
本文从几个不同的方面来探讨如何从C语言教学中阐明指针的地位和作用,借以说明指针在C语言编程中的特殊重要性。  相似文献   

17.
通过对数组中的地址进行分类 ,并用不同的方式描述了各类地址及元素引用 ,揭示了不同指针表达式的本质区别 ,详细阐明了数组与指针的关系。  相似文献   

18.
在C语言的学习中,数组与指针的应用是重点和难点,尤其多维数组和指针应用已成为学习和掌握C语言的一大障碍。利用消维法和图示法,通过二维、三维数组与指针的关系,延伸到多维数组的探讨,让学习C语言的人轻松的理解和接受利用指针法对多维数组元素取值的方式。  相似文献   

19.
针对学生在学习指针过程中遇到的困难及使用指针过程中出现的常见错误,本文讨论指针的概念、指针与数组的关系、指针与函数的关系、指针作为函数参数的实质,帮助学生克服这一困难。  相似文献   

20.
首先阐述了地址、数组与指针的概念,通过分析推理的方法使指针、数组和函数结合应用这一复杂难以掌握的问题得以轻松的解决。重点讲解在指针中易犯的错误、指导学生上机实践调试程序两个方面介绍了C语言指针教学中的经验和体会。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号